With its Arctic white gelcoat, stylish graphics package, lustrous burl wood accents and a fiberglass sport spoiler, it's easy to fall for the Sea Ray 290 Sundancer based on looks alone. But to make sure it's just as appealing from a practical standpoint, Sea Ray included a wealth of operational systems. Consider just the short list: automatic bilge pump, electric bilge blower, power steering, power tilt and trim, Lowrance 3500 digital depth finder, dockside power, even a freshwater washdown with cockpit shower, and concealed dockside water inlet. The large, extended swim platform and transom door makes it easy to board from the dock or the water, especially since the stainless steel swim ladder can be stowed away in its own dedicated compartment. The 290 Sundancer has a powerful standard engine package - twin 4.3L Bravo II MCM stern drives with 190 horsepower to get away from it all, fast. An upgraded list of gas-powered twin and diesel stern drive options are also available for the 2000 model year. The cockpit on the Sea Ray 290 Sundancer was designed for maximum efficiency with features like a self-bailing fiberglass cockpit liner, full instrumentation with weatherproof switches and circuit breaker panel, a high water bilge pump and alarm system at the helm, a covered chart tray forward of helm and a curved, tinted windshield with power vent. Functionality aside, the cockpit was also clearly built for all-day fun with room for family and friends to travel in style. The seating arrangement offers a double helm seat with flip-up thigh-rise bolster for dual driving positions. The aft-facing seat has a storage compartment built into its base. For sun seekers, there's a portside sun lounger that's well cushioned and well within reach of the cockpit wet bar that has its own cooler and faucet. To gain even more space for sunning, an optional aft cockpit table that converts into a sunpad can be added. Finally, the aft bench seat in the stern folds neatly away for easy access to the engine when the gas-assisted hatch is raised. Inside, the spacious cabin of the Sea Ray 290 Sundancer has a four-person dinette that easily converts to extra sleeping space when not in use. There's also a roomy forward V-berth for a comfortable night's rest. Push aside the privacy curtain, set up the stowable V-berth table, toss on the standard throw pillows and there's the perfect conversation area. The cabin area has three deck hatches with screens and sky screen covers, four opening portlights, and four hull windows to keep it light and provide plenty of fresh air. In the mid stateroom, a double bunk provides perfect guest quarters with mirrored bulkheads, a storage cabinet, and a curved sliding window with screen. The 290 Sundancer also features deep stain-resistant 40-ounce carpet, and a Clarion AM-FM digital cassette stereo with amplifier, six speakers and cockpit remote control to further enhance the environment. Durable, easy-to-clean molded fiberglass is used in the galley countertop and sink area with 6' 3" headroom. Sea Ray included all the necessities like a standard dual-voltage refrigerator, recessed two-burner electric stove, a microwave oven and more. The head and vanity feature a full fiberglass enclosed standup head with a shower and curtain, power vent and a VacuFlush toilet with fiberglass settee lid. The 1997 Sea Ray 290 Sundancer has garnered positive feedback from customers who appreciate its blend of style, comfort, and performance on the water
Many boaters praise its spacious cabin, which features a well-designed galley and sleeping accommodations for multiple guests, making it an ideal choice for weekend getaways and longer excursions. Owners often highlight the boat’s smooth ride and reliable performance, powered by twin engines that offer a good balance of speed and fuel efficiency. The layout is frequently noted for being user-friendly, with a well-placed helm that provides excellent visibility. Moreover, the ample deck space and integrated swim platform receive positive remarks, as they enhance the overall experience for lounging and entertaining. The 290 Sundancer's classic lines and thoughtful amenities make it a pleasure to own, and many customers express satisfaction with its durability and low maintenance needs over the years. Overall, the 1997 Sea Ray 290 Sundancer is regarded as a versatile and enjoyable vessel, perfect for both new and seasoned boaters looking to create lasting memories on the water.

1997 Sea Ray 290 Sundancer: Pros and Cons
Pros
Spacious Interior: The 290 Sundancer offers a roomy cabin with comfortable seating, making it ideal for weekend getaways or entertaining guests.
Versatile Layout: The split cabin design incorporates a versatile salon with a convertible dinette and a well-equipped galley, allowing for multi-functional use of the space.
Strong Performance: Powered by twin engines, this boat delivers impressive performance on the water, providing an exhilarating and smooth ride.
Quality Construction: Sea Ray is known for its high-quality build and attention to detail, ensuring durability and longevity in marine environments.
Well-Designed Cockpit: The cockpit layout is user-friendly, featuring ample seating and a functional helm, perfect for navigating and enjoying time on the water.
Storage Solutions: With various storage compartments throughout the boat, the 290 Sundancer helps keep your gear organized and out of the way.
Stylish Design: Classic lines and a sporty profile give the 290 Sundancer an attractive look that stands out on the water.
Cons
Age Considerations: As a 1997 model, some components may require updates or maintenance due to wear and tear over the years.
Fuel Efficiency: The twin-engine setup, while powerful, may lead to higher fuel consumption compared to single-engine vessels.
Limited Offshore Capabilities: Although suitable for inland and coastal cruising, the 290 Sundancer is not designed for long-distance offshore trips.
Storage Space: While there is storage available, it may be limited for longer outings or for those bringing larger amounts of gear.
Cabin Height: The cabin might feel cramped for taller individuals due to its limited headroom in certain areas. The 1997 Sea Ray 290 Sundancer combines style, comfort, and performance, making it a solid choice for boaters who appreciate classic design and a well-thought-out layout. However, potential buyers should consider the age-related factors and maintenance needs associated with older models.
